9 Contracts Awarded for Singapore-Johor Bahru RTS Link Systems
System Works for the Rapid Transit System Link (RTS Link) project between Singapore and Johor Bahru are progressing well. SMRT announced on Wednesday (May 12) that RTS Link operator, RTS Operations Pte Ltd (RTSO), recently awarded nine contracts, totalling around S$320 million. SMRT Implements Handy Lift Availability Feature to Mobile App
Commuters can look forward to receiving real-time information on lift availability at SMRT train stations through the rail operator’s mobile app. This serves as an additional way for commuters to receive official information about lift availability at MRT stations, in addition to the MyTransport.SG mobile app by the Land Transport Authority (LTA). ‘May I Have a Seat Please?’ Initiative Beneficial for Commuters With Invisible Medical Conditions
The ‘May I have a seat, please?’ initiative began as a pilot programme by the Land Transport Authority (LTA) through the Caring SG Commuters national movement in October 2019, to alert commuters about fellow passengers with invisible medical conditions who may require a seat while on public transport.
LTA Completes Rigorous Testing of Thomson-East Coast Line Stage 2; Hands Over Stations to SMRT
Marking a key milestone for the Thomson-East Coast Line Stage 2 (TEL2), the Land Transport Authority (LTA) announced on Friday (Apr 30) the handing over of TEL2 stations and operations to rail operator SMRT. Arrival of New 3rd Generation Trains for North East Line
In a Facebook post by the Land Transport Authority (LTA) on 4 April 2021, the new third-generation trains for the North East Line (NEL) have arrived in Singapore! Groundbreaking for Singapore-Johor Bahru RTS Link
Construction for the Rapid Transit System (RTS) linking Singapore and Johor Bahru (Malaysia) officially began following a groundbreaking ceremony held at Woodlands North in Singapore on Jan 22. Changes to Thomson-East Coast Line Operating Hours from January to April 2021
Early Closure and Late Opening arrangements for the Thomson-East Coast Line (TEL) will be extended till 30 April 2021 for additional testing hours for the system integration with Stage 2 of the line.
